Detailed explanation-1: -Solid state technology is used in storage media such as solid state drives (SSD) and USB flash drives. The technology is called solid state as it does not have any moving parts, unlike magnetic and optical devices.

Detailed explanation-2: -Solid state devices use non-volatile random access memory (RAM) to store data indefinitely. They tend to have much faster access times than other types of device and, because they have no moving parts, are more durable.

Detailed explanation-3: -Conventional drives tend to wear out after about three years of use. SSDs don’t use conventional spinning “platters” to store data, so there are fewer moving parts. Under optimal conditions, an SSD can be used for ten years or more without any hardware issues. This makes SSD ideal for long term data storage.

Detailed explanation-4: -Because it has no moving parts, an SSD is not subject to the same mechanical failures that can occur in HDDs. SSDs are also quieter and consume less power. And because SSDs weigh less than hard drives, they are a good fit for laptop and mobile computing devices.

Detailed explanation-5: -Solid-state storage (SSS) is a type of computer storage media that stores data electronically and has no moving parts. Solid state storage is made from silicon microchips. Because there are no moving parts, SSDs require less power and produce far less heat than spinning hard disk drives or magnetic tape.
